Decoding Common Cosmetic Ingredients
Many ingredients you encounter are benign and serve vital functions such as providing color, texture, or preservation. However, some substances warrant closer examination due to their potential for irritation, allergic reactions, or long-term adverse effects.
Emulsifiers: The Unsung Heroes (and Potential Villains)
Emulsifiers are essential for blending oil and water-based ingredients, creating stable and pleasant textures in your makeup. Without them, your foundation might separate into distinct layers of oil and liquid.
Common Emulsifiers and Their Role
- Glyceryl Stearate: A widely used emulsifier derived from glycerin and stearic acid, often found in moisturizers and foundations. It helps create a smooth feel.
- Cetearyl Alcohol: Despite its name, this is a fatty alcohol, not a drying alcohol. It acts as an emollient and emulsifier, contributing to product texture.
- Polysorbates (e.g., Polysorbate 20, Polysorbate 80): These are ethoxylated compounds that help solubilize oils in water-based formulas. While generally considered safe, some concerns exist regarding potential contaminants from the ethoxylation process.
Potential Concerns with Emulsifiers
- Irritation and Sensitivity: For individuals with sensitive skin, certain emulsifiers can disrupt the skin’s natural barrier, leading to dryness, redness, and breakouts.
- Ethoxylation Byproducts: The process of ethoxylation can sometimes lead to the formation of 1,4-dioxane, a potential carcinogen. Reputable manufacturers often take steps to minimize or remove these byproducts.
Preservatives: The Guardians of Longevity
Preservatives are vital for preventing microbial growth within your makeup products. Without them, bacteria, yeast, and mold could proliferate, turning your favorite lipstick into a petri dish of potential infection.
Essential Preservatives in Cosmetics
- Parabens (Methylparaben, Propylparaben, Butylparaben): Historically, parabens have been highly effective and widely used preservatives. They work by inhibiting the growth of microorganisms.
- Phenoxyethanol: A broad-spectrum preservative that is often used as a paraben alternative. It is effective against bacteria and yeast.
- Formaldehyde Releasers (e.g., DMDM Hydantoin, Imidazolidinyl Urea): These preservatives slowly release small amounts of formaldehyde to prevent microbial contamination.
The Debate Surrounding Preservatives
- Paraben Concerns: While regulatory bodies in many regions consider parabens safe at the concentrations used in cosmetics, some studies have raised concerns about their potential endocrine-disrupting properties. This has led to a consumer demand for “paraben-free” products.
- Formaldehyde and Its Releasers: Formaldehyde is a known carcinogen and allergen. While the amounts released by cosmetic preservatives are generally considered very low, individuals with formaldehyde sensitivity may experience allergic reactions.
- Alternative Preservation Systems: The industry is increasingly exploring alternative preservation methods, including natural preservatives and antimicrobial packaging, to address consumer concerns.
Fragrance: The Seductive Scent and Its Hidden Dangers
Fragrance is a powerful tool in the cosmetic industry, capable of evoking emotions and preferences. It’s often the first sensory appeal of a product.
Understanding Fragrance Components
- “Fragrance” or “Parfum”: This single word on an ingredient list can represent a complex mixture of dozens or even hundreds of individual chemicals, including natural extracts and synthetic compounds. The precise composition is often proprietary information.
The Allergic Potential of Fragrances
- Allergenic Compounds: Many components within fragrance mixtures are known allergens. These can trigger contact dermatitis, manifesting as redness, itching, and swelling.
- Respiratory Irritation: For some individuals, inhaling fragrance compounds can exacerbate asthma or cause respiratory irritation.
- “Fragrance-Free” vs. “Unscented”: It’s important to distinguish between these terms. “Fragrance-free” products contain no intentionally added fragrance ingredients. “Unscented” products may contain masking fragrances to cover up inherent odors of other ingredients.

Identifying Potentially Harmful Ingredients
Beyond the functional categories, certain ingredients have garnered attention for their potential to cause more significant harm. Vigilance in identifying these substances can protect your skin from undue stress and potential long-term health implications.
The Controversial Ingredients
Several ingredients appear frequently in cosmetic formulations but have faced scrutiny due to scientific studies or consumer concerns.
Talc: A Powdery Concern
Talc, a mineral composed of magnesium, silicon, and oxygen, is widely used for its absorbency and smoothing properties, particularly in powders like eyeshadow, blush, and setting powders.
Applications of Talc in Makeup
- Absorbency: It helps absorb excess oil, contributing to a matte finish.
- Texture Enhancement: It provides a silky feel and aids in product application.
- Pigment Suspension: It helps distribute color evenly.
Concerns Regarding Talc Purity
- Asbestos Contamination: The primary concern with talc is its potential to be contaminated with asbestos, a known carcinogen. Natural talc deposits can be found alongside asbestos deposits, making purification a critical step.
- Inhalational Risks: Inhaling talc particles, particularly in powdered forms, can pose respiratory risks, irrespective of asbestos content.
- Ovarian Cancer Link (Debated): Some studies have suggested a possible link between talc use in the genital area and an increased risk of ovarian cancer, though this link remains a subject of ongoing scientific debate and research.
Heavy Metals: The Uninvited Guests
Heavy metals are naturally occurring elements that can find their way into makeup through pigments or environmental contamination. While some may be present in trace amounts, their accumulation or direct application can be problematic.
Common Heavy Metals Found and Their Sources
- Lead: Often found in some lipsticks and hair dyes, its presence is primarily attributed to contamination of pigments.
- Mercury: Historically used as a preservative, mercury is now largely phased out but can still be detected in some older or unregulated products.
- Arsenic: Can be present as a contaminant in pigments.
- Cadmium: Another pigment-related contaminant.
Health Implications of Heavy Metals
- Neurological Damage: Lead and mercury are known neurotoxins that can affect cognitive function and development.
- Kidney and Liver Damage: Chronic exposure to various heavy metals can impair organ function.
- Carcinogenicity: Some heavy metals, like arsenic and cadmium, are classified as carcinogens.
- Skin Irritation and Allergic Reactions: Certain metals can also cause direct irritation or allergic responses on the skin.
Microbeads: The Tiny Environmental Menaces
While more commonly associated with skincare scrubs, microbeads (small plastic particles) have also appeared in some makeup products, such as exfoliators or volumizing mascaras, to add texture or physical exfoliation.
The Purpose of Microbeads in Makeup
- Exfoliation: To physically buff away dead skin cells.
- Texture Enhancement: To add grittiness or a desirable tactile sensation.
Environmental and Health Concerns
- Non-Biodegradability: These plastic particles do not biodegrade and persist in the environment, contributing to plastic pollution.
- Entry into Food Chain: They can be ingested by aquatic life and subsequently enter the human food chain.
- Potential Skin Damage: While intended for exfoliation, improper use or harsh microbeads can cause micro-tears in the skin, compromising its barrier function. Many regions have now banned the use of microbeads in rinse-off products.
Understanding Your Skin Type and Sensitivity

Your skin is not a blank canvas; it’s a unique ecosystem with its own needs and predispositions. What works harmoniously for one person might trigger a cascade of issues for another. Understanding your skin type and identifying sensitivities is paramount to selecting safe and beneficial makeup.
Recognizing Your Skin’s Unique Profile
Different skin types react differently to various ingredients. A product that is a miracle worker for oily skin might be an arid desert for dry skin, and vice versa.
Oily Skin: The Shine-Prone Predicament
Oily skin produces an excess of sebum, which can lead to a shiny appearance, enlarged pores, and a propensity for blemishes.
Makeup Considerations for Oily Skin
- Oil-Free and Non-Comedogenic: Look for products labeled “oil-free” and “non-comedogenic,” meaning they are formulated not to clog pores.
- Matte Finishes: Products designed to provide a matte finish can help control shine throughout the day.
- Absorbent Ingredients: Ingredients like kaolin clay or silica can help absorb excess oil.
- Potential Irritants: Avoid heavy, occlusive formulas that can exacerbate oiliness and breakouts.
Dry Skin: The Thirsty Terrain
Dry skin lacks sufficient moisture and lipids, often appearing dull, rough, and prone to flakiness and tightness.
Makeup Considerations for Dry Skin
- Hydrating and Emollient Formulas: Opt for creamy, moisturizing foundations and concealers that provide hydration and create a dewy finish.
- Avoid Alcohol-Based Products: High concentrations of alcohol can be stripping and further dehydrate the skin.
- Nourishing Ingredients: Look for ingredients like hyaluronic acid, glycerin, and natural oils (e.g., jojoba oil, shea butter) to replenish moisture.
- Creamy Textures: Cream blushes and highlighters tend to blend more seamlessly without emphasizing dry patches.
Sensitive Skin: The Reactive Landscape
Sensitive skin is easily irritated and prone to redness, itching, burning, and stinging in response to certain ingredients or environmental factors.
Makeup Considerations for Sensitive Skin
- Hypoallergenic and Dermatologist-Tested: While not a guarantee, these labels suggest products have been formulated to minimize allergic reactions.
- Fragrance-Free and Dye-Free: These are common triggers for sensitivity and should be avoided.
- Minimal Ingredient Lists: Fewer ingredients often mean fewer potential irritants.
- Patch Testing: Always perform a patch test on a small, inconspicuous area of skin before applying a new product to your entire face.
Acne-Prone Skin: The Blemish-Prone Battleground
Acne-prone skin is characterized by frequent breakouts, blackheads, whiteheads, and inflammation.
Makeup Considerations for Acne-Prone Skin
- Non-Comedogenic and Oil-Free: This is paramount to avoid exacerbating breakouts.
- Salicylic Acid: Some makeup products include salicylic acid, a beta-hydroxy acid that can help exfoliate and unclog pores.
- Soothing Ingredients: Ingredients like green tea extract or chamomile can help calm inflammation.
- Avoid Harsh Scrubbing: When removing makeup, use gentle techniques to avoid further irritating acne lesions.
The Role of Regulations and Certifications

The safety of cosmetic products isn’t solely left to the consumer’s discretion. Regulatory bodies and voluntary certifications play a role in establishing safety standards and providing consumer assurance.
Navigating the Regulatory Landscape
Government agencies often set guidelines and regulations for the cosmetic industry to protect public health.
Regional Regulatory Bodies and Their Mandates
- Food and Drug Administration (FDA) in the United States: The FDA regulates cosmetics under the Federal Food, Drug, and Cosmetic Act. However, it does not pre-approve cosmetic products or ingredients (except for color additives). Manufacturers are responsible for ensuring the safety of their products and labeling.
- European Commission (EC) in the European Union: The EU has a more stringent regulatory framework, with the Cosmetics Regulation (EC) No 1223/2009 requiring comprehensive safety assessments and detailed ingredient listings.
- Health Canada: Canada also has regulations in place to ensure the safety of cosmetics sold within the country.
Key Regulatory Concerns
- Prohibited and Restricted Substances: Regulatory bodies maintain lists of ingredients that are either banned or restricted in cosmetic products due to safety concerns.
- Labeling Requirements: Clear and accurate ingredient labeling is mandated to inform consumers.
- Adverse Event Reporting: Mechanisms are in place for reporting adverse reactions to cosmetic products.
Understanding Certification Labels
Various certifications offer consumers an additional layer of assurance regarding product safety and ethical sourcing.
Common Certification Types and What They Mean
- Cruelty-Free: This certification indicates that the product and its ingredients have not been tested on animals. Organizations like PETA (People for the Ethical Treatment of Animals) and Leaping Bunny provide these certifications.
- Vegan: Vegan certification signifies that the product contains no animal-derived ingredients.
- Organic and Natural Certifications (e.g., USDA Organic, ECOCERT): These certifications ensure that products meet specific standards regarding the sourcing and processing of ingredients, with a focus on natural and organic components. However, “natural” is not a legally defined term, so understanding the certifying body’s standards is crucial.
- Dermatologist-Tested and Hypoallergenic: As mentioned earlier, these labels aim to indicate products formulated to minimize the risk of irritation or allergic reactions, though they are not always independently verified.

Beyond selecting safe products, your application and maintenance habits are crucial to protecting your skin. Think of your makeup bag as a culinary pantry; proper storage and handling are as important as the quality of the ingredients themselves.
Maintaining Product Hygiene and Application Techniques
Good hygiene practices are the frontline defense against bacterial contamination and potential skin infections.
The Importance of Clean Tools and Hands
- Washing Hands: Always wash your hands thoroughly before applying makeup to prevent transferring bacteria to your face and products.
- Cleaning Brushes and Sponges: Makeup brushes and sponges are breeding grounds for bacteria. Clean them regularly (at least once a week for brushes, more often for sponges) with a gentle cleanser and allow them to dry completely. Makeup brush cleaners or mild soap and water are effective.
- Replacing Old Products: Bacteria can accumulate in makeup over time, especially in liquid or cream formulations. Discard old, expired, or discolored products. Mascaras typically have the shortest shelf life (3-6 months) due to the risk of eye infections.
Proper Application and Removal
- Avoid Double-Dipping: When using communal applicators in store, avoid dipping directly into the product multiple times.
- Gentle Removal: Always remove all makeup before going to bed. Use a gentle makeup remover or cleanser that effectively removes your specific makeup type without stripping the skin. Avoid harsh rubbing or tugging, which can damage the skin barrier.
- Sharing with Caution: Avoid sharing makeup, especially eye and lip products, as this can transmit infections.

FAQs
1. How can I determine if my makeup is safe for my skin?
To determine if your makeup is safe, check the ingredient list for known irritants or allergens, ensure the product is within its expiration date, and observe how your skin reacts after use. Patch testing new products on a small skin area can also help identify potential adverse reactions.
2. What ingredients should I avoid in makeup products?
Avoid makeup containing harmful ingredients such as parabens, phthalates, formaldehyde-releasing preservatives, heavy metals like lead, and synthetic fragrances if you have sensitive skin. These substances can cause irritation, allergic reactions, or long-term health concerns.
3. How often should I replace my makeup products?
Makeup products should be replaced according to their expiration dates, typically every 3 to 12 months depending on the product type. Mascara and liquid eyeliners should be replaced every 3 months, while powders and lipsticks can last up to 1-2 years. Using expired makeup increases the risk of bacterial contamination.
4. Can makeup cause skin problems like acne or irritation?
Yes, certain makeup products can clog pores, cause irritation, or trigger allergic reactions, leading to acne or other skin issues. Using non-comedogenic, hypoallergenic, and dermatologist-tested products can help minimize these risks.
5. How should I properly remove makeup to keep my skin safe?
Proper makeup removal involves using a gentle cleanser or makeup remover suited to your skin type, followed by washing your face with a mild cleanser. Removing makeup thoroughly before sleeping helps prevent clogged pores, irritation, and potential infections.
